On Mon, Feb 11, 2002 at 11:16:45PM -0800, Lars Jensen wrote:
> When have both icewm and gnome on my machine, and want to be able to
> start up icewm without gnome starting up, so I have used
> update-alternatives to set my default x-window-manager. However when I
> start up icewm gnome also starts up, and I get both the icewm menubar,
> and the gnome menubar on top at the bottom of the window.
>
> How do I start icewm without gnome also starting up?
>
> [...]
Hello Lars,
check ~/.xsession for gnome-relational entries and uncomment them
eventually.
Basically my ~/x.session contains nothing but:
exec icewm
I hope this helps.
